It is also not possible to purchase stock in its parent company, Menard, Inc., as the company has remained private as well. There is no indication that Menards will ever be a public company. The majority of the business is owned by Jonh Menard Jr. who is likely content with his business being private. He has become a billionaire from this business so why complicate it with shareholders? Founded by John Menard Jr. in 1960, Menard Inc. now operates 310 Menards home-improvement stores across the Midwest, making it the third-largest such chain in the United States.
